In 'Wings of Fire', the narrative wraps around themes of perseverance and resilience, which resonate profoundly with me. The journey of A.P.J. Abdul Kalam depicts how determination can lead to monumental achievements, transcending one's humble beginnings. His backstory reveals that every setback can be a foundation for future success. This theme is incredibly relatable, especially for anyone who has had to face life's challenges head-on. You find inspiration in his struggles, like how he navigated through poverty and societal obstacles while dreaming big.
Also, the importance of education shines throughout the book. It's not just about formal schooling but the sheer quest for knowledge and self-improvement. Kalam's curiosity drove him to explore science and technology, embodying the idea that learning is a lifelong journey. I think this resonates with many of us in today's fast-paced world, where continuous learning is essential. His life reminds us that education can be a powerful tool for change, not only for oneself but for society.
Finally, 'Wings of Fire' delves deeply into the theme of national pride and service. Kalam's commitment to India’s growth as a nation through his work in ISRO and DRDO reflects a duty to contribute to the greater good. This inspires readers to think about their roles in society, reminding us that passion and purpose can lead to significant impacts. The author of 'Wings of Fire' is Dr. A.P.J. Abdul Kalam, a name that resonates with inspiration and perseverance. In this incredible book, he combines his own journey from humble beginnings to becoming one of India's most respected scientists and later, the President. What I find truly captivating is how he weaves in the essence of dreams and hard work, showing that anyone can achieve greatness with determination. Each chapter feels like a lesson, not just about rocket science, but about life itself. He shares stories of his childhood in Rameswaram, his early days in engineering, and the challenges he faced while working on India's space and missile programs. It’s so much more than just an autobiography; it’s a call to action for young minds to reach for the stars and break through barriers.
